Transcribed Image Text:The accompanying data on \( x = \) current density (\( \text{mA/cm}^2 \)) and \( y = \) rate of deposition (\( \mu\text{m/min} \)) appeared in an article. Do you agree with the claim by the article's author that "a linear relationship was obtained from the tin-lead rate of deposition as a function of current density"?
\[
\begin{array}{c|cccc}
x & 20 & 40 & 60 & 80 \\
\hline
y & 0.24 & 1.15 & 1.61 & 2.12 \\
\end{array}
\]
Find the value of \( R^2 \). (Round your answer to three decimal places.)
